Photovoltaic Power Plant Distribution Network Automation

A PV power plant distribution network automation system integrates monitoring, control, protection, and communication to ensure safe, efficient, and optimized operation of distributed solar generation.

System Overview

A PV power plant distribution network automation system is designed to manage grid-connected photovoltaic power generation efficiently. It integrates protection, monitoring, control, and communication functions to maintain power quality, prevent islanding, isolate faults rapidly, and optimize energy output . The system typically adopts a hierarchical and distributed architecture, including station control, bay-level, and process-level layers, and complies with IEC 61850 standards for interoperability and data exchange .

Key Components and Functions

  • Real-time Monitoring: Tracks PV modules, inverters, combiner boxes, and transformers, measuring voltage, current, power, and temperature .
  • Data Logging and Analysis: Records energy yield, irradiance, and ambient conditions, enabling historical performance analysis and predictive maintenance .
  • Fault Detection and Protection: Provides inverter shutdown alerts, string failures, and communication loss notifications, supporting rapid fault isolation and anti-islanding protection .
  • Performance Optimization: Uses automatic generation control (AGC), automatic voltage control (AVC), and solar power forecasting to maximize generation efficiency .
  • Remote Management: Enables automated alarms, remote monitoring, and data analytics to reduce operation and maintenance costs .

Control Strategies

High penetration of distributed PV systems introduces challenges such as voltage over-limit, power reversal, and harmonic pollution in distribution networks . To address these, modern automation systems implement:

  • Distributed Cluster Voltage Control: Divides the network into active and reactive clusters, coordinating inverters to regulate voltage and reduce control nodes .
  • Hierarchical Optimization: Combines local inverter control with system-wide coordination to respond quickly to fluctuations in PV generation .
  • Reactive Power Compensation: Allocates reactive power based on PV capacity ratios to mitigate voltage overshoot and maintain network stability .

Communication and Smart Grid Integration

Integration into a smart grid requires two-way communication and automated control to manage distributed energy resources effectively . Last-mile communication networks support real-time data collection, analysis, and coordinated control, enabling:

  • Grid-scale coordination for high PV penetration
  • Automated Volt/VAR control to maintain voltage within limits
  • Enhanced reliability and operational efficiency through centralized and distributed decision-making

Benefits

  • Enhanced Reliability: Fast fault detection and isolation minimize outage risks .
  • Optimized Operation: Improved energy yield and efficient voltage regulation .
  • Smart Management: Remote monitoring, automated alarms, and data analytics reduce O&M costs .
  • Grid Stability: Mitigates voltage over-limit and reactive power issues in high PV penetration networks . In summary, a PV power plant distribution network automation system combines hierarchical control, real-time monitoring, fault protection, and smart communication to ensure safe, efficient, and optimized operation of distributed photovoltaic resources while supporting integration into modern smart grids .
